World Cup 2026: A Historic Semi-Final Lineup (2026)

The FIFA World Cup 2026 has seen a groundbreaking development as the top four ranked teams have, for the first time, reached the semi-finals. This achievement is not just a testament to their prowess but also a result of FIFA's strategic decision to alter the draw process for the 2026 tournament. The primary objective was to ensure that these powerhouse teams would not face each other until the semi-finals, thereby preserving the excitement and competitiveness of the tournament.

The top-ranked teams, Spain, Argentina, France, and England, were strategically placed in separate quadrants, ensuring they could not meet before the semi-finals. This move was a calculated risk, as it required each team to win their respective groups, which they successfully accomplished. The separation in the draw also meant that Spain and Argentina, two of the favorites, were kept apart until the final, adding an extra layer of intrigue to the tournament.

This innovative approach to the draw process is reminiscent of other sporting events, such as Wimbledon and the new Champions League format, where seeds are kept apart in pairs. FIFA's decision to introduce FIFA rankings in 1994, initially not used for that year's tournament, has now played a pivotal role in shaping the tournament's structure. However, it's worth noting that in the past, top-ranked teams like Belgium, Germany, Spain, Italy, and France have not always progressed to the semi-finals, highlighting the unpredictability of the World Cup.

The 48-team World Cup format, with its expanded knockout stage, presented a unique challenge. With an extra knockout round, early meetings between group winners became not only possible but almost inevitable. This was evident in the last 16 stage of this summer's tournament, where the United States faced Belgium, England played Mexico, and Switzerland met Colombia. FIFA, recognizing the potential for these blockbuster matches to overshadow other games, made the strategic decision to separate the top-ranked teams, ensuring that the tournament remained competitive and exciting throughout.
